Can You Tell Me what Word is ging it a Problem?
For example, size is a keyword as in:
{size 24 Hello}

If you want to insert a long text then enclose the text with double quotes to avoid it being converted to Math formatting, for example,
{"This is an example of how to change the font size to 24 point using the command size 24 Hello"}

MrChips

Joined Oct 2, 2009
30,807
It is a ? because it is expecting some more information.

Have you tried using the double quotes?

{"Put everything in between two double quotes such as this"} over {"then you can type anything"}
